, but this code // executes before the first paint, when

麻豆区

is not yet present. The // classes are added to so styling immediately reflects the current // toolbar state. The classes are removed after the toolbar completes // initialization. const classesToAdd = ['toolbar-loading', 'toolbar-anti-flicker']; if (toolbarState) { const { orientation, hasActiveTab, isFixed, activeTray, activeTabId, isOriented, userButtonMinWidth } = toolbarState; classesToAdd.push( orientation ? `toolbar-` + orientation + `` : 'toolbar-horizontal', ); if (hasActiveTab !== false) { classesToAdd.push('toolbar-tray-open'); } if (isFixed) { classesToAdd.push('toolbar-fixed'); } if (isOriented) { classesToAdd.push('toolbar-oriented'); } if (activeTray) { // These styles are added so the active tab/tray styles are present // immediately instead of "flickering" on as the toolbar initializes. In // instances where a tray is lazy loaded, these styles facilitate the // lazy loaded tray appearing gracefully and without reflow. const styleContent = ` .toolbar-loading #` + activeTabId + ` { background-image: linear-gradient(rgba(255, 255, 255, 0.25) 20%, transparent 200%); } .toolbar-loading #` + activeTabId + `-tray { display: block; box-shadow: -1px 0 5px 2px rgb(0 0 0 / 33%); border-right: 1px solid #aaa; background-color: #f5f5f5; z-index: 0; } .toolbar-loading.toolbar-vertical.toolbar-tray-open #` + activeTabId + `-tray { width: 15rem; height: 100vh; } .toolbar-loading.toolbar-horizontal :not(#` + activeTray + `) > .toolbar-lining {opacity: 0}`; const style = document.createElement('style'); style.textContent = styleContent; style.setAttribute('data-toolbar-anti-flicker-loading', true); document.querySelector('head').appendChild(style); if (userButtonMinWidth) { const userButtonStyle = document.createElement('style'); userButtonStyle.textContent = `#toolbar-item-user {min-width: ` + userButtonMinWidth +`px;}` document.querySelector('head').appendChild(userButtonStyle); } } } document.querySelector('html').classList.add(...classesToAdd); })(); College project to visit all USA counties pivots into career - News & Stories | 麻豆区

麻豆区

Skip to main content

Spark

College project to visit all USA counties pivots into career

Sat, Sep 01, 2018

A pastor鈥檚 kid, Tom Byker 鈥05 had lived in six states by the time he arrived at Calvin. 鈥淚 loved the travel,鈥 he said, 鈥渁nd tracking where I鈥檇 been.鈥

Not surprisingly, the travel enthusiast made his way to the geography department. He also began teaching himself GIS鈥攇eographic information science鈥攖o make digital maps of the places he鈥檇 visited.

鈥淚 decided to start from scratch and visit every county,鈥 Byker said. 鈥淟earning the mapping software was an excuse to see the whole country.鈥

Each May, on the way to his summer job on a fishing boat in the Bering Sea, he drove a different route. When he came to the boundary of a new county, he snapped a picture of the county-identifying sign. By graduation he鈥檇 visited 60 percent of the nation鈥檚 3,142聽counties and plotted them on his map with 17 categories of data, like 鈥減laces of interest,鈥 for each.

That map became part of the resume虂 Byker submitted to TomTom, then a primary manufacturer of personal navigation devices (PNDs). 鈥淭hey thought it was a little quirky, but it definitely helped me get the job.鈥

In his first year at the company, Byker drove a vehicle with mounted cameras recording data鈥攍ike intersection configurations, business locations, traffic flow鈥攖hat TomTom needed for its navigational maps. When smartphone technology made PNDs far less relevant, TomTom shifted its business. Byker now works from his home computer in Cincinnati collecting geographic data, refining it, and transferring it to existing maps to accurately reflect changes in the landscape.

For example, for the new I-69 freeway being built from Indianapolis to Texas, he gathered detailed construction plans from Indiana鈥檚 Department of Transportation and overlaid them onto TomTom鈥檚 existing map of the state so the new map accurately reflects reality when the highway opens.

Full-time work and marriage slowed Byker鈥檚 work on his all-county map. But in January 2017, he flew to Kalawao County on the Hawaiian island of Moloka鈥檌, then to Kalaupapa, remote site of a former leper colony.

鈥淭hat was the most meaningful visit for me,鈥 he said, 鈥渘ot just because it was the last county in a 15-year project, but because of its story. Father Damien, a Catholic priest, gave his life to the lepers forced to live there. His selfless example was inspiring.